Section 722.859 - [Repealed Effective 91 days after adjournment of the 2024 Regular Session sine die] Surrogate parentage contract for compensation prohibited; surrogate parentage contract for compensation as misdemeanor or felony; penalty
(1) A person shall not enter into, induce, arrange, procure, or otherwise assist in the formation of a surrogate parentage contract for compensation.
(2) A participating party other than an unemancipated minor female or a female diagnosed as being intellectually disabled or as having a mental illness or developmental disability who knowingly enters into a surrogate parentage contract for compensation is guilty of a misdemeanor punishable by a fine of not more than $10,000.00 or imprisonment for not more than 1 year, or both.
(3) A person other than a participating party who induces, arranges, procures, or otherwise assists in the formation of a surrogate parentage contract for compensation is guilty of a felony punishable by a fine of not more than $50,000.00 or imprisonment for not more than 5 years, or both.

Repealed by 2024, Act 24,s 2, eff. 91 days after adjournment of the 2024 Regular Session sine die.
Amended by 2014, Act 69,s 3, eff. 3/28/2014.
1988, Act 199, Eff. 9/1/1988.
